The PayingAgent shall maintain the stock register, which shall contain a list of the Holders, the number of shares held by each Holder and the address of each Holder. The Paying Agent shall record in the stock register any change of address of a Holder upon notice by such Holder. In case of any written request or demand for the inspection of the stock register or any other books of the Company in the possession of the Paying Agent, the Paying Agent will notify the Company and secure instructions as to permitting or refusing such inspection. The Paying Agent reserves the right, however, to exhibit the stock register or other records to any person in case it is advised by its counsel that its failure to do so would (i) be unlawful or (ii) expose it to liability, unless the Company shall have offered indemnification satisfactory to the Paying Agent.

The PayingAgent shall establish and maintain a Payment Account, which shall be a separate trust account and an Eligible Account, in which the Master Servicer shall cause to be deposited from funds in the Certificate Account or, to the extent required hereunder, from its own funds (i) at or before 10:00 a.m., New York time, on the Business Day preceding each Distribution Date, by wire transfer of immediately available funds, any Periodic Advance for such Distribution Date, pursuant to Section 3.03 and (ii) at or before 10:00 a.m., New York time, on the Business Day preceding each Distribution Date, by wire transfer of immediately available funds, (a) an amount equal to the Pool Distribution Amount, (b) Net Foreclosure Profits, if any, with respect to such Distribution Date and (c) the amount of any recovery in respect of a Realized Loss. The Master Servicer may cause the Paying Agent to invest the funds in the Payment Account. Any such investment shall be in Eligible Investments, which shall mature not later than the Business Day preceding the related Distribution Date (unless the Eligible Investments are obligations of the Trustee, in which case such Eligible Investments shall mature not later than the Distribution Date), and shall not be sold or disposed of prior to maturity. All income and gain realized from any such investment shall be for the benefit of the Master Servicer and shall be subject to its withdrawal or order from time to time. The amount of any losses incurred in respect of any such investments shall be deposited in the Payment Account by the Master Servicer out of its own funds immediately as realized. The Paying Agent may withdraw from the Payment Account any amount deposited in the Payment Account that was not required to be deposited therein and may clear and terminate the Payment Account pursuant to Section 9.01.
